要编写自己的 API 接口,请遵循以下步骤:定义接口:确定目的、端点、请求和响应结构。选择技术栈:选择开发框架和数据持久化技术。实现接口:编写代码处理请求逻辑和数据。部署 API:将 API 部署到服务器,配置安全措施。文档化接口:创建 API 文档,描述端点、请求响应和使用说明。版本控制:管理 API 版本,跟踪更改,提供向后兼容性。持续改进:监视 API 使用情况,根据反馈进行更新,提高性能和可用性。
如何编写自己的 API 接口
编写自己的 API 接口并不复杂,它可以让你在不同的应用程序和系统间交换数据。以下步骤将指导你创建自己的 API 接口:
1. 定义接口
- 确定 API 的目的和它将支持的端点。
- 为每个端点设计请求和响应结构。这包括定义请求参数和响应数据格式。
- 考虑使用行业标准规范,如 REST 或 GraphQL,来定义接口。
2. 选择技术栈
- 根据你选择的语言和框架选择一个开发框架或库。
- 考虑使用 API 网关或反向代理服务器来管理和保护你的 API。
3. 实现接口
- 编写代码来实现接口的请求处理逻辑。
- 使用适当的数据持久化技术来处理和存储数据。
- 测试你的代码以确保其正确运行并符合预期行为。
4. 部署 API
- 将你的 API 部署到服务器或云平台。
- 配置防火墙和安全措施以保护 API 免遭未经授权的访问。
- 设置监控和日志记录以跟踪 API 的性能和错误。
5. 文档化接口
- 创建 API 文档,描述其端点、请求和响应格式以及使用说明。
- 考虑使用 Swagger 或 OpenAPI 等工具来生成交互式文档。
6. 版本控制
- 管理 API 的版本并记录更改。
- 使用版本控制系统来跟踪 API 的演变并提供向后兼容性。
7. 持续改进
- 根据用户的反馈和使用情况监视和改进你的 API。
- 定期更新和优化代码以提高性能、安全性和可用性。
以上是api接口怎么自己写的详细内容。更多信息请关注PHP中文网其他相关文章!